Description
In this edition of FAO's State of Food Insecurity in the World, estimates indicate that the trend in global hunger reduction continues: about 805 million people were estimated to be chronically undernourished in 2012-14, down by more than 100 million over the last decade and by 209 million compared to 1990/92.
This means that the Millennium Development Goal hunger target of halving the proportion of undernourished people by 2015, is within reach.
Yet today, about one in every nine people in the world still do not have enough food to conduct an active and healthy life.
